Residential flood insurance requires accurate property data, zone determination, elevation inputs, and precise underwriting rules. Flood placement is often time sensitive and highly regulated, yet many MGAs and wholesalers still rely on fragmented systems and manual workflows to quote and issue flood coverage efficiently.
Selectsys built a production-ready Residential Flood rating platform that enables MGAs and wholesalers to rate, quote, bind, issue, and manage residential flood policies within a single unified system. The platform is live today and designed for program business, delegated authority, and wholesale distribution models.
The Residential Flood Rating Platform operates within the broader Selectsys Commercial & Specialty Rating Platform. This allows flood to be managed alongside Homeowners, Commercial Property, and other specialty lines in a single operational environment.

For carriers and flood programs that support API based workflows, Selectsys enables real time residential flood rating and quoting directly from the platform. Where supported, workflows extend from quote through bind and policy issuance.
New residential flood carrier API integrations can typically be delivered in approximately six weeks, assuming carrier access and documentation are available.
For delegated authority and program business, Selectsys supports proprietary residential flood rating where rates and underwriting logic are owned by the MGA or carrier. This enables faster program launches and greater control over underwriting models without custom platform development.
